What inspired the design? 

The client requested a fresh brand identity that encapsulates the brand’s purpose, evoking the nostalgia and the authentic feel of what mornings are for people all around the world. Jasmyn aimed for a brand identity that connects with conscious and strong-willed people on a human level through a mix of bold and soft elements, elevated by a youthful and gritty tone of voice.

What is unusual or innovative about this pack? 

The first product of the Morning People line is the CBD-infused Vitamin-C Sunbaked serum. The packaging design is meant to reflect Morning People’s core message of empowerment and the product’s lift-me-up effect, as Vitamin C has energizing and anti-aging effects, while CBD leaves the skin supple, rejuvenated, and adequately hydrated. The packaging sets the customer expectations at first glance: by using this product, you’ll start your morning putting your best face forward. As to the color palette, Mariam opted for a mix of warm and cold tones inspired by sunrises, mornings, and mundane life. She created a gradient color inspired by the spectrum of the sunrise dawn sky for the boxes, linked to the brand’s name. All the visual elements were chosen purposefully, ensuring they look alluring and vibrant when printed on recycled glass, a material selected to minimize the brand’s environmental impact.
